HBase 创建空表

Apache HBase是一个开源的、分布式的、分布式存储系统。它是Apache Hadoop项目的一个子项目,用于提供高可靠性、高性能和可伸缩性的分布式存储服务。在HBase中,表是按行键排序的,允许快速的随机访问和批量读写操作。

在HBase中,我们可以通过HBase Shell或Java API来创建空表。下面将演示如何使用HBase Shell创建一个空表。

步骤

  1. 首先,启动HBase服务并进入HBase Shell。
$ start-hbase.sh
$ hbase shell
  1. 使用create命令创建一个空表。表名为test_table,列族为cf1
create 'test_table', 'cf1'
  1. 使用list命令查看已创建的表。
list
  1. 成功创建空表后,我们可以开始往表中插入数据、查询数据等操作。

代码示例

create 'test_table', 'cf1'
list

旅行图

journey
    title HBase创建空表流程
    section 启动服务
        StartHBaseService: 启动HBase服务
        EnterHBaseShell: 进入HBase Shell
    section 创建空表
        CreateEmptyTable: 创建空表
        ListTables: 查看已创建的表
    section 完成
        InsertData: 往表中插入数据
        QueryData: 查询数据

结论

通过以上步骤,我们成功地使用HBase Shell创建了一个空表。在实际应用中,根据需求可以根据需要在表中添加列族、调整分区等。HBase的分布式存储特性使得它可以处理大规模数据,并保证数据的高可靠性和高性能。希望这篇文章对你了解HBase创建空表有所帮助。